Horizontal and Vertical Shifts Using f(x) = x^4
In this video, we'll explore how to perform both horizontal and vertical shifts on the parent function f(x) = x^4. This quick example demonstrates how shifting transformations work, moving through the process a bit faster for those who are looking for a quick refresher on graph transformations. Ideal for anyone familiar with basic graphing techniques who wants to brush up on shifting transformations.
What You Will Learn:
How to shift a function vertically and horizontally.
Understanding transformations of the parent function f(x) = x^4
.Quick tips on graphing and interpreting shifted functions
